Ngaruruhoe Activity

ui uiiuc iiuu vu.y Ngauruhoe was active all day on Sunday and huge columns of ashladen steam rose to great heights and drifted to the north-west. The northern slopes of the volcano were blackened. The view of the mountain at sunrise at Taupo was magnificent.
